I've seen adserver opt-out's before like for Doubleclick, etc., however if they're blocked in your HOSTS file there's no need to even bother letting them cookie you with instructions not to track you. I'd personally rather trust the HOSTS file over them!!!

If I understand this correctly (http://www.networkadvertising.org/managing/faqs.asp#question_9), you would need to exempt that cookie (http://www.networkadvertising.org/managing/faqs.asp#question_11) from being deleted by CCleaner. Otherwise the "opt-out" would be deleted each time your run CCleaner.

you would need to exempt that cookie ...

It's not one cookie, it's a cookie for every company in that list! I just tried it, and it created about 100 cookies. Needless to say, I will not exempt any of these, and continue to clean cookies with CCleaner.

yeah, this seems fairly simlar to the BeefTaco and Taco add-ons for firefox in that they create the opt out cookie for each opt-out-able site
